Solution for 3y+11=-4(y-8) equation:



3y+11=-4(y-8)
We move all terms to the left:
3y+11-(-4(y-8))=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(-4(y-8)), so:
-4(y-8)
We multiply parentheses
-4y+32
Back to the equation:
-(-4y+32)
We get rid of parentheses
3y+4y-32+11=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7y-21=0
We move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right
7y=21
y=21/7
y=3
